John Stewart Barney
American (1869-1925)
American artist John Stewart Barney was born in Richmond, Virginia in 1869. During his diverse career he worked as a painter, architect, sculptor and writer. Barney completed a series of three marble relief sculptures that adorn the entrance to the Hart Memorial Building of the Troy Public Library in Troy, New York. However, his specialty was landscape paintings in which he captured the spectacular mountain, river, and coastal vistas of the northeast. Barney held membership in the Newport Art Association and later died in New York City in 1925.
